Dale Koehler

CHARLES CITY, Iowa - Dale Koehler, 89, of Rockford, died Saturday, August 04, 2007, at the Hospice Inpatient Unit in Mason City.

Memorial services for Dale Koehler will be held 2 p.m. Friday at the Hauser Funeral Home in Charles City. Pastor LaVonne Kaasa of the West St. Charles United Methodist Church will officiate. Inurnment will be at a later date in the West St. Charles Cemetery, rural Charles City.

Friends may call at the Hauser Funeral Home in Charles City from 5 to 8 p.m. on Thursday. Visitation will continue an hour prior to the service at the funeral home on Friday.

Dale Edward Koehler was born August 5, 1917, in Floyd County, the son of Edward and Emma (Heitz) Koehler. He graduated from the Rockford High School, and attended the University of Minnesota where he met Myra Sutherland. On November 27, 1940, they were united in marriage in Eyota, Minn. Dale farmed in the Rockford area all of his life. He served the community in many ways including, the Rockford School Board, the Rockford Elevator Board, Omnitel Communications Board and as a Floyd County Supervisor. He was an active member of the West St. Charles United Methodist Church, rural Charles City. His interests included, wood working, farming, and his family.
